The body of a deceased male found last Tuesday afternoon in Grand Meadow Township has been identified as that of an Iowa man.

Mower County Sheriff’s Deputies and the Grand Meadow Ambulance Squad were dispatched at 2:55 p.m. on the afternoon of November 10th to the 69000 block of 260th Street in Grand Meadow Township for a report of a deceased male located in a ditch.

Sheriff Steve Sandvik reported Monday that the deceased male was identified as 67-year old David Warne Sutter of Waterloo, Iowa.  Sheriff Sandvik went on to state that an investigation into the cause of Sutter’s death is ongoing through the medical examiner’s office.  Sandvik went on to indicate that there are no apparent indications of foul play, or immediate concerns for public safety.
